Rev. Rebecca Trovalli is a Licensed Local pastor, having completed the Virginia Conference licensing school in 2014. She hopes to pursue her M.Div and ordination during her time at Salem.
Rebecca served the Buckingham charge, consisting of Hanes Chapel, Browns Chapel, and Rocky Mount UMCs from 2014-2019. Before that she served as a lay supply pastor for two years in Cumberland at Antioch UMC as she completed the requirements for candidacy and licensing.
Rebecca served the church prior to pastoral ministry as the coordinator of young adult ministries in Roanoke through Windsor Hills UMC, as a conference youth intern, and as a Calling21 intern, and as a lay speaker. She grew up participating beyond her local church in the Farmville district youth ministries where she crafted her first sermons.
Rebecca grew up in Nottoway Va on the Nottoway-Lunenburg charge. She was brought to faith by the incredible people of St Mark’s UMC. In 2014 she married, Clayton Cook of Prince Edward Va. Together they have a 3 year old daughter Anastasia and a two year old Australian Shepherd, Hank.
Rebecca’s passion in ministry includes a focus on cultural shifts, mutual mentoring across generational lines, helping others wrestle with their faith, and exploring the WHY of our faith traditions as Methodists and as Christians.
